Joni Lamb: Overview and Public Profile

Joni Lamb is a Christian television figure best known as the co-founder and president of Daystar Television Network alongside her husband, Dr. Marcus Lamb. Her public work centers on ministry, media outreach, and philanthropic initiatives connected to faith-based broadcasting. Marriage and Partnership with Marcus Lamb

Joni married Marcus Lamb in 1987. Their partnership led to the founding of Daystar Television Network in 1997. She has often described their collaboration as complementary, with shared goals of spreading Christian teachings through mass media. The stability of their long-term relationship has been a recurring theme in coverage about the Lamb family.

Daystar Television and Ministry Work

Co-Founding Daystar Television Network

Joni and Marcus Lamb started Daystar with a small television station in Texas. The network grew into a broad-based Christian television organization offering programming that includes worship services, talk shows, and children’s content. Joni serves as president, overseeing operations and representing Daystar in public forums and fundraising initiatives.
